Initial Water Assessment
First, we’ll carefully assess the extent of the water damage. This involves identifying the source of the water, how long it was present, and how deeply it has penetrated the drywall and surrounding materials. We use specialized moisture meters to detect hidden water, ensuring no area is overlooked. Accurate assessment is crucial for effective repair. This step typically takes a few hours, depending on the size of the affected area.
Water Extraction and Drying
If there’s still standing water or excessive moisture, we’ll extract it using professional-grade equipment. Then, we set up powerful drying systems, including air movers and dehumidifiers. These machines work to rapidly reduce humidity levels and dry out the affected materials, including the drywall and insulation behind it. Proper drying prevents mold and further deterioration. This stage can last anywhere from 24 to 72 hours, depending on the severity of the water intrusion.
Damaged Drywall Removal
Once everything is thoroughly dried, we’ll remove the compromised drywall. We carefully cut away any sections that are stained, softened, or showing signs of mold growth. Our goal is to remove only what’s necessary to ensure a stable and healthy repair. We minimize disruption by being precise. This process usually takes a few hours to a full day, depending on how much drywall needs to be replaced.
Repair and Installation
After the old drywall is gone, we’ll install new drywall to match the existing wall. We carefully tape, mud, and sand the new sections to create a smooth surface. Our technicians pay close attention to detail to ensure the new drywall integrates perfectly with your existing walls. We create smooth surfaces for a flawless finish. This step can take one to three days, allowing for proper drying time between mudding coats.
Finishing and Painting
The final step is making your walls look like new again. We apply primer to the new drywall and then paint the repaired areas to match your existing wall color. If needed, we can paint the entire wall or room for a perfect match. We restore your walls’ beauty. This finishing work typically takes one to two days to complete.

Warning Signs You Need Drywall Water Damage Repair
Catching water damage early is the best defense against costly repairs and potential health hazards like mold. Your drywall can tell you a lot if you know what to look for. Keep an eye out for these common signs that indicate you might need professional drywall water damage repair. Early detection saves you stress. Being aware helps you protect your home.
Discolored Stains and Spots
The most obvious sign is often discoloration. You might see brown, yellow, or even reddish-brown spots on your walls or ceiling. These are water stains and indicate that water has soaked through the paint and drywall material. Stains are a clear warning that moisture is present.
Sagging or Bulging Drywall
When drywall gets saturated with water, it loses its rigidity. You might notice areas that are drooping, sagging, or bulging outwards. This is a sign that the internal structure of the drywall is compromised and needs immediate attention. Sagging means structural weakness.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int
Water trapped behind paint can cause it to bubble up or peel away from the drywall surface. If you see sections of paint that are no longer adhering smoothly to the wall, it’s a strong indicator of moisture issues underneath. Bubbling paint signals moisture.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Even if you can’t see visible damage, a persistent musty or moldy smell is a major red flag. This often means there’s hidden moisture and potential mold growth within your walls, which can spread if left untreated. Bad smells mean hidden problems.
Cracks or Crumbling Edges
Waterlogged drywall can become brittle and start to crack, especially around seams or edges. You might also notice the material crumbling when touched. This indicates the drywall has lost its integrity. Crumbling drywall needs replacement.
Drywall Water Damage Repair v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small, fresh water spot on an accessible wall | Yes, if you’re comfortable with patching and painting. | Minor spots can often be patched with a small piece of drywall and some spackle. | |
| Large stain covering more than a square foot | Yes | Larger areas indicate deeper saturation and potential for hidden mold or structural issues. | |
| Visible sagging or bulging drywall | No | Yes | This suggests the drywall material is compromised and needs professional assessment for structural integrity. |
| Water damage from a sewage backup or contaminated source | Absolutely Not | Yes | Contaminated water poses serious health risks and requires specialized containment and cleanup protocols. |
| Recurring water spots or dampness | No | Yes | This points to an ongoing leak that needs to be located and repaired before further drywall damage occurs. |
| Any sign of mold growth (black, green, or white fuzzy spots) | No | Yes | Mold remediation requires specific safety measures and expertise to prevent spores from spreading. |
While small, superficial water spots might seem like a DIY job, any significant damage, especially if it involves sagging, mold, or recurring issues, is best handled by professionals. Drywall Water Damage Repair Cost In White Settlement, TX
The cost for drywall water damage repair in White Settlement, TX, can vary quite a bit. Factors like the size of the damaged area, the depth of the water intrusion, and whether mold has started to grow all play a role. These price ranges are estimates to give you an idea. We provide transparent pricing so you know what to expect. Our goal is to offer fair value for essential repairs.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Minor Drywall Patching (up to 2 sq ft) | $300 – $700 | Includes material, labor, texturing, and painting to match. |
| Moderate Drywall Replacement (2-10 sq ft) | $700 – $2,500 | More extensive removal, installation, and finishing work required. |
| Large Drywall Replacement (over 10 sq ft) | $2,500 – $6,000+ | Significant structural work, potential need for framing repair, and extensive finishing. |
| Water Extraction and Structural Drying | $500 – $3,000+ | Depends on the volume of water, size of space, and duration of drying needed. |
| Mold Assessment and Remediation (if necessary) | $1,000 – $5,000+ | Cost varies greatly based on the extent and type of mold present. |
| Priming and Painting Repaired Areas | $200 – $600 | Cost depends on the number of coats, wall height, and if custom matching is needed. |

Common Questions About Drywall Water Damage Repair
What’s the first thing I should do if I notice water damage on my drywall?
The very first thing you should do is try to stop the source of the water if it’s safe to do so. Then, if it’s a small amount of water, try to blot up excess moisture with towels. For anything more significant, or if you can’t find the source, call our team immediately. We can help assess the situation and begin the drying process to prevent further damage. Prompt action is vital.
How long does it typically take to repair water-damaged drywall?
The timeline can vary, but a typical repair for moderate damage might take 3 to 5 days. This includes time for drying, removing the old drywall, installing new drywall, mudding, sanding, and painting. We work efficiently to get your home back to normal as quickly as possible. Complex situations or extensive drying might extend this timeline. We provide realistic timelines.
Is it safe to just paint over a water stain on my drywall?
While you can paint over a stain with the right primer, it’s generally not recommended as a permanent solution if the underlying issue isn’t resolved. Painting over a stain without addressing the moisture source or properly preparing the area can lead to the stain reappearing or mold growth. We address the root cause, not just the symptom. We ensure lasting results.
Will my insurance cover drywall water damage repair?
In many cases, yes, especially if the damage is due to a sudden and accidental event like a burst pipe or a storm. However, coverage often depends on the cause of the water intrusion. Damage from slow leaks or poor maintenance might not be covered. We can help document the damage for your insurance claim. We recommend contacting your insurance provider directly to understand your policy details.
How can I prevent water damage to my drywall in the future?
Regular maintenance is key. This includes checking for roof leaks, ensuring gutters are clean and functioning, inspecting pipes for any signs of leaks, and properly sealing bathrooms and kitchens.
